Doris MCP Server

Doris MCP (Model Context Protocol) Server is a backend service built with Python and FastAPI. It implements the MCP, allowing clients to interact with it through defined "Tools". It's primarily designed to connect to Apache Doris databases, potentially leveraging Large Language Models (LLMs) for tasks like converting natural language queries to SQL (NL2SQL), executing queries, and performing metadata management and analysis.

Core Features

  • MCP Protocol Implementation: Provides standard MCP interfaces, supporting tool calls, resource management, and prompt interactions.
  • Streamable HTTP Communication: Unified HTTP endpoint supporting both request/response and streaming communication for optimal performance and reliability.
  • Stdio Communication: Standard input/output mode for direct integration with MCP clients like Cursor.
  • Enterprise-Grade Architecture: Modular design with comprehensive functionality:
    • Tools Manager: Centralized tool registration and routing with unified interfaces (doris_mcp_server/tools/tools_manager.py)
    • Enhanced Monitoring Tools Module: Advanced memory tracking, metrics collection, and flexible BE node discovery with modular, extensible design
    • Query Information Tools: Enhanced SQL explain and profiling with configurable content truncation, file export for LLM attachments, and advanced query analytics
    • Resources Manager: Resource management and metadata exposure (doris_mcp_server/tools/resources_manager.py)
    • Prompts Manager: Intelligent prompt templates for data analysis (doris_mcp_server/tools/prompts_manager.py)
  • Advanced Database Features:
    • Query Execution: High-performance SQL execution with advanced caching and optimization, enhanced connection stability and automatic retry mechanisms (doris_mcp_server/utils/query_executor.py)
    • Security Management: Comprehensive SQL security validation with configurable blocked keywords, SQL injection protection, data masking, and unified security configuration management (doris_mcp_server/utils/security.py)
    • Metadata Extraction: Comprehensive database metadata with catalog federation support (doris_mcp_server/utils/schema_extractor.py)
    • Performance Analysis: Advanced column analysis, performance monitoring, and data analysis tools (doris_mcp_server/utils/analysis_tools.py)
  • Catalog Federation Support: Full support for multi-catalog environments (internal Doris tables and external data sources like Hive, MySQL, etc.)
  • Enterprise Security: Comprehensive security framework with authentication, authorization, SQL injection protection, and data masking capabilities with environment variable configuration support
  • Web-Based Token Management: Secure localhost-only interface for complete token lifecycle management with database binding, real-time statistics, and enterprise-grade access controls (doris_mcp_server/auth/token_handlers.py)
  • Unified Configuration Framework: Centralized configuration management through config.py with comprehensive validation, standardized parameter naming, and smart default database handling with automatic fallback to information_schema

System Requirements

  • Python: 3.12+
  • Database: Apache Doris connection details (Host, Port, User, Password, Database)

🚀 Quick Start

Installation from PyPI

# Install the latest version
pip install doris-mcp-server

# Install specific version
pip install doris-mcp-server==0.6.0

💡 Command Compatibility: After installation, both doris-mcp-server commands are available for backward compatibility. You can use either command interchangeably.

Start Streamable HTTP Mode (Web Service)

The primary communication mode offering optimal performance and reliability:

# Full configuration with database connection
doris-mcp-server \
    --transport http \
    --host 0.0.0.0 \
    --port 3000 \
    --db-host 127.0.0.1 \
    --db-port 9030 \
    --db-user root \
    --db-password your_password 

Start Stdio Mode (for Cursor and other MCP clients)

Standard input/output mode for direct integration with MCP clients:

# For direct integration with MCP clients like Cursor
doris-mcp-server --transport stdio

🌐 Token Management Interface (New in v0.6.0)

Access the Web-Based Token Management Dashboard for enterprise-grade token administration:

Secure Access Requirements

  • Localhost Access Only: Interface restricted to 127.0.0.1 and ::1 for maximum security
  • Admin Authentication: Requires TOKEN_MANAGEMENT_ADMIN_TOKEN for access
  • Configuration Prerequisites:
    # Required environment variables
    ENABLE_HTTP_TOKEN_MANAGEMENT=true
    ENABLE_TOKEN_AUTH=true
    TOKEN_MANAGEMENT_ADMIN_TOKEN=your_secure_admin_token
    TOKEN_MANAGEMENT_ALLOWED_IPS=127.0.0.1,::1
    

Interface Access

# Access the token management interface
http://localhost:3000/token/management?admin_token=your_secure_admin_token

Available Operations

  • 📊 Token Statistics: Real-time overview of active, expired, and total tokens
  • ➕ Create Tokens:
    • Basic information (ID, description, expiration)
    • Database binding (host, port, user, password, database)
    • Custom token values or auto-generated secure tokens
  • 📋 Token Management:
    • List all tokens with database binding status
    • One-click token revocation
    • Automated expired token cleanup
  • 🔒 Enterprise Security:
    • All operations require admin authentication
    • Real-time IP validation
    • Complete audit logging
    • Automatic persistence to tokens.json

🔐 Security Note: The interface is designed for localhost administration only. It cannot be accessed remotely, ensuring maximum security for token management operations.

Verify Installation

# Check installation
doris-mcp-server --help

# Test HTTP mode (in another terminal)
curl http://localhost:3000/health
